For the Consumer show, yes, you will be able to purchase from the vendors. The Convention and Trade show, however, there is not supposed to be any sales...it's against the rules. The Convention and Trade show are for wholesalers to see new product and place pre-orders for the new stuff.

I'm assuming that you're talking about the Consumer show on the 31st & 1st. I don't know about any discounts because this is the very first year for the Consumer show. It's all new to everyone.

This is the first year that CHA (Craft and Hobby Association) has held their trade show in Florida, and the first year that they have done a consumer show. Normally their trade show/convention are held twice a year with the winter show in Anaheim, California and the summer show in Chicago, so this is new for them. Their trade show/convention is held for people in the trade (store owners, designers, educators, etc.), but the consumer show is open to anyone who wants to attend.
